If I may answer these questions also, In my opinion, NFSv4 and SambaV4 are both mature robust protocols with known idiosyncrasies. The basic configuration for both protocols is pretty straightforward these days. In fact there is more in common than most realize.
Libre Office file locking problems are mostly with Samba these days unfortunately. There are workarounds for both Windows and Samba based file shares. Some of these are quite ugly. If you aren't having problems with file locking with Samba/LO files then stick with what you are doing. The problem is with LO and Gnome GVFS, not with Samba.
On the other hand; when NFSv4 was implemented the problems with files locking went away, so I've been told.
Samba and NFS can live peaceably on the same host. Be aware that the same LO file locking problems can exist. I have a host the servers files using both protocols with no problems at all. The user UID/GID habits are applicable with both protocols. Good housekeeping speaks for itself in many ways.
As far as security goes, there are multiple aspects to that paradigm. A VPN will provide an encrypted tunnel so that nothing is transported in clear text, but it will do nothing for you if your attacker has gained access to your network. Both NFS and Samba (Windows Sharing) are LAN technologies at heart. The VPN provides that LAN type of environment. You need to provide all the normal authentication and authorization for your users as you would normally in a LAN situation. Kerbros provides the authentication (who are you) for NFS. Samba has internal mechanisms (Samba user TDB databases) for this. The Linux file system itself provides the authorization (you can do that) for both protocols. Both security mechanisms (authorization/authentication need to be addressed.
Edit: If the integrity of an individual LO document is important, then I would look to version control not file locking per se.

5. I don't understand this: "the UPPER CASE X adds executable only on existing eXecutable file bits." Please elucidate.
The execute bit is used for different reasons depending on whether it object is a file or a directory. The setting execute bit for a directory means that the user (or group or others) can read the contents and traverse that directory into a subdirectory. This is the X. Setting the execute bit on a file means that that file is executable (such as a program or script). Since we only need to set the execute bit on files we need to use the X rather than x to set the bit on directories. If there are file that are already executable it does not matter. Files that are not executable are not disturbed.
6. I don't understand when we would sudo chmod using numbers and when using ug=rwX, for example. I'm gathering that there are things you cannot do (as easily) with just the numbers?
The above is one reason. There are others, such as, adding a SGID bit on a directory. I set all of this up on an empty directory using octal 2775. This sets the SGID bit and the directory permissions. No data is affected as there is none.

A warning when changing userids and groupids. If any are being reused - then the order of these changes is VERY IMPORTANT and each change should have the file system changes made before the next change to the files in /etc/. The actual numbers used are not important, so I would NOT reuse any of the userid/groupids. There is nothing special about them being the same or even having a groupid with the same name as the userid - that is something that Ubuntu added. It is NOT standard across all Linux system or Unix. It isn't a bad idea and on single-user systems, can make life easier. On systems where people will always work together, I don't really see the point for the individual groups.
There are many subtle file/directory permissions so working through a good tutorial using these test account for 30-60 minutes would be highly recommended. I haven't found any tutorials that cover more than the basic permissions. In a multi-user environment, a thorough understanding is required and can make life for your users simple. After mastering group file and directories, learn about chmod g+s so the shared directories for use by teams working together always have the correct group.
http://www.cyberciti.biz/faq/linux-setup-shared-directory/ is the closest tutorial that I've found, though it doesn't talk about the results or umask settings required for this to work in a team environment.

The answer to the first question is: Those permissions are not needed to accomplish your goal of multi user access for some and no access for others. The answer to the second question is: As we did before using symbolic notation (rwx or X) and the recursive switch (-R) with the chmod command.
It helps to understand how permissions are set upon the creation of any new file or directory. All files created start with the permissions of 666 and all the directories that are created start with the permissions of 777. The umask (see man umask) then acts upon these objects to provide the ultimate file or directory permissions. The umask for Ubuntu is 0002. The umask is simply subtracts the value from the created permissions (i.e. 0666 or 0777). This is why all files ultimately have the permissions of 0664 and all directories ultimately have the permissions of 0775. There is one exception to this. That is the umask for the root user is 0022 instead of 0002, so the files created by root are 0644 and the directories are 0755.
These permissions work fine of multi user environments. If you needed to keep others from seeing any of the files or subdirectories you only need to change the directory permissions on the root directory of that branch of the file system. Setting the permissions to 0770 makes that directory non world readable by stopping others from reading that directory or traversing that directory into the subdirectories.
There is one other item you would need to do and that is setting the SGID bit on the root directory of that branch of the file system. This sets group inheritance of all files and directories created below that directory. When this is set up correctly a file will have the ownership set with the owner being the creator and the group being the same as the root directory of this branch.
The only files/directories that need to have the ownership and permissions set are the ones already created below that root directory (e.g /data or /srv or even /srv/data).
The next task is to create a directory that we can use to experiment with. Try these commands (the # lines are just comments)
Edited this to correct my errors BAB1
#make all the subdirectories with one command
sudo mkdir -p /srv/testdir/testdata
#New command: Set the directory permissions for all users (775)
sudo chmod -R 775 /srv
#Set group ownership of /srv/testdir
sudo chgrp -R data /srv/testdir
#Set SGID bit for inheritance of the group ownership
sudo chmod -Rg+s /srv/testdir
# New command: test that you can create a file
touch /srv/testdir/testdata/file1
Lastly, if you want to restrict the others group
## restrict users other than the group data from the directory test data
# set the permissions on testdir to 0770
sudo chmod 0770 /srv/testdir
At this point all users in the group data can create and read/write files and subdirectories. The group will always be the group data. They will have the permissions set at 664 for files and 775 for directories (actually 2775 with the sgid bit set). No other users will be allowed access.

I was under the impression that all the users that had access to the share were in the datauser group. I would have done something like this
[apps]
path = /srv/apps
valid users = @data
force group = data
writeable = yes
create mask = 0660
directory mask = 2770
[client]
path = /srv/client
valid users = @data
force group = data
writeable = yes
create mask = 0660
directory mask = 2770
Note that both shares are identical except for location. The valid users are all the users in the data user group. The permissions on the file are rw for user and the group. This overrides the umask setting of 664. That was a concern of yours. The directory mask sets the sugid bit and allows all users in the data user group to access the shared directory.
You need to restart the smbd daemon for Samba to see the new configuration. You do that with this command
sudo service smbd restart
To check the configuration of the smb.conf file you can use this command
testparm -s ...you can scroll back to the top and see the errors if there are any. The config you see is only the correct items. The incorrect parameters will not be displayed.
